The Story Behind the BMW 3.0 CSL – Video
The BMW 3.0 CSL is a legendary racing car and icon in the BMW Motorsport portfolio. Built by Karmann between 1968 and 1975, the BMW 3.0 CSL was a svelte 2,400lbs with 3.2-liter (340 hp) and later with 3.5-liter (440 hp) engines. Its aerodynamics earned it the nickname “Batmobile,” and established BMW as a premier racing team.
